HODA Kotb has given her verdict on who should take her place on the Today Show with her ex co-host, Jenna Bush Hager.
The beloved daytime TV personality said goodbye to the Today Show in January after seven years in January.

Since then, Jenna Bush Hager has been joined by a rotation of guest hosts who appear for a number of episodes before being changed.
Appearing on Watch What Happens Live, host Andy Cohen grilled Hoda on what she’s seen of her replacements, and asked who she thinks should take over.
Thinking about her answer, Hoda said: “I mean, anybody would be so lucky. But to me, the contenders are Savannah [Guthrie]; I think she would be great; I think Justin Sylvester is amazing.”
“Scarlett Johansson crushed it,” she added, echoing hundreds of fans who praised the Avengers star’s stint.
When Andy noted that the Oscar-nominated actress “wasn’t going to do it every day”, Hoda seemed hopeful regardless.
“I know, but wouldn’t it be…. she said it was her favorite job!”
Hoda went on to add: “Matt Rogers is great, and also our dear friend Chanel Jones.
“I feel like it’s whoever clicks great with Jenna. I think that’s the one.”
Since Hoda’s exit, the show has been renamed to ‘Today with Jenna & Friends‘.
On top of the previously mentioned names, Jenna has been joined by SNL star Ego Nwodim – who prompted an emotional moment when she was surprised by her mom – as well as Taraji P Henson, Keke Palmer and Eva Longoria.
Olivia Munn also proved to be a favorite among viewers, who urged Today to ‘just hire her already’.
But it seems the decision has already been made, with The U.S. Sun exclusively revealing Sheinelle Jones as the official replacement.
According to a source, Sheinelle, 46, “has the job” but added how there will not be an announcement until after her leave of absence has ended.
She has been away from Today since December, and has been silent on social media as well.
Sheinelle only returned to Instagram briefly on January 15 to issue a statement about her coping with a “family health matter.”
